BART Approves Contract for US Airport Connector Project

22 September 2010


The Bay Area Rapid Transit (BART) board in the US has approved the award of a contract to design, operate and maintain the proposed Oakland airport connector.

The $484m project will provide an improved transit connection between Oakland Airport and BART's Coliseum Station.

Following final approval by the California Transportation Commission for the allocation of $20m for the project, BART will sign the contract with the two firms.

The project will begin later this year and is scheduled to be complete in three-and-a-half years.
